Toyota has extended its deepest sympathies and condolences to all those affected by the 2026 Kumamoto Earthquake, announcing a package of emergency aid measures in response.

Relief Supplies and Vehicle Support for Affected Areas

Working alongside vehicle dealers, Toyota Rental & Leasing stores, Toyota Motor Kyushu, and related group companies, Toyota will provide relief supplies, lend vehicles, and dispatch disaster relief volunteers to affected municipalities and other organizations.

This includes deploying power supply vehicles such as the Moving e to deliver emergency electricity at evacuation centers. Toyota said it will work to identify what aid is most needed and provide support accordingly.

Donations to Relief Organizations

Toyota is donating a total of 30 million yen, split among the Japanese Red Cross Society, the Central Community Chest of Japan, and Japan Platform.

The company said it will continue coordinating with the government, local authorities, and relief organizations while closely monitoring conditions on the ground to determine further support, expressing hope for the earliest possible recovery of the affected areas.
